Output 4efec23ccf06a60230b3523f0cd43abbf3502ffd01514cb1170d8b60c11195f2:1

value
6500146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84702d019c77a4c58bca5fba1baa478e2db8a22e OP_EQUAL
address
3DmHVycsoWVsddS5es7wdCy8wLgPw1vFJq
transaction
4efec23ccf06a60230b3523f0cd43abbf3502ffd01514cb1170d8b60c11195f2
spent
true